Ottawa police looking for witnesses to indecent exposure incident in Stittsville
Posted Jun 24, 2022 02:20:43 PM.
The Ottawa Police Service (OPS) is looking to speak to possible witnesses after an indecent exposure in Stittsville.
According to police, two girls under the age of 16 were standing at the intersection of Abbott Street West and Stittsville Main around 3:45 p.m. on Wednesday, June 22, when they were approached by a vehicle.
Police say the male driver rolled down the windows and called out to the girls before exposing his genitals. Both girls left the area without any further incident.
The suspect is described as:
- White
- 30's
- Medium build
- Brown eyes
- Short brown hair
- Brown scruffy beard
He was wearing an orange construction vest and brown khaki pants at the time.
The vehicle is described as a green four-door sedan with rust on the bottom of the doors, light brown seats and silver bars on the roof.
